Hangzhou Hota M&E Holdings Co., Ltd. operates as a specialized industrial machinery manufacturer focused on vertical material conveying systems. The company's core revenue model centers on designing, manufacturing, and selling customized bucket elevators and conveyor components for heavy industrial applications. Its product portfolio includes plate chain bucket elevators, belt bucket elevators, and critical fragile accessories such as chains, hoppers, and steel wire tapes, serving capital-intensive industries requiring robust material handling solutions. Operating within the industrial machinery sector, Hota caters primarily to cement and building materials producers, port operators, steel mills, and chemical plants across global markets. The company has established a niche position by providing integrated conveying equipment rather than standalone components, offering clients comprehensive system solutions. With operations spanning China, Southeast Asia, the Middle East, Africa, and the Americas, Hota leverages its technical expertise to maintain competitive positioning in industrial infrastructure development projects. The company's market position benefits from its vertical integration capabilities and longstanding relationships with industrial clients in emerging markets where infrastructure growth drives demand for material handling equipment.
Hota generated CNY 250.8 million in revenue for the period, demonstrating solid operational scale within its specialized industrial niche. The company maintained strong profitability with net income of CNY 57.5 million, reflecting efficient cost management and pricing power in its target markets. Operating cash flow of CNY 100.3 million significantly exceeded net income, indicating high-quality earnings and effective working capital management. Capital expenditures of CNY 48.6 million suggest ongoing investment in production capacity and technological upgrades to support future growth initiatives.

Hota maintains an exceptionally strong balance sheet with CNY 568.6 million in cash and equivalents, representing substantial liquidity reserves. Total debt of merely CNY 8.5 million indicates a conservative financial strategy with minimal leverage, providing significant buffer against industry cyclicality. The company's net cash position supports operational stability and strategic flexibility for potential acquisitions or capacity expansion.
